Syracuse's zone defense is 40-plus years in the making, while Duke's adoption of the zone is still in its infancy. But both teams have been getting great results as of late heading into their all-ACC Sweet 16 NCAA Tournament showdown Friday night in Omaha. Which side holds the betting value here?

March Madness point spread: The Blue Devils opened as 11.5-point favorites; the total is at 133.5, according to sportsbooks monitored by OddsShark. (Line updates and matchup report)

March Madness betting pick, via OddsShark computer: 73.3-62.1, Blue Devils (March Madness picks on every game)

Why Syracuse can cover the spread

The Orange advanced to this Sweet 16 by winning three games already in this tournament. First they edged Arizona State in a First Four bout 60-56, then they tipped TCU 57-52, and most recently they nipped highly regarded Michigan State 55-53.

Syracuse beat the Sun Devils outright as two-point dogs, the Frogs as five-point dogs and the Spartans as 10-point dogs.

The Orange trailed Michigan State almost all day but finally took a lead for good at 49-48 with four minutes to go. In the end, Syracuse used the foul-first method to keep the Spartans from even attempting a game-tying three-pointer, and it worked perfectly.

On the day, the Orange only shot 35.7 percent from the field but hit 24 of 31 free throws and held Michigan State to a miserable 25.8 percent FG shooting, forcing the Spartans to miss their last 13 shots.

Two days prior, Syracuse held TCU to just under 40 percent FG shooting, and two days before that they held Arizona State to 40 percent shooting. So the Orange have limited each of their last 10 opponents to under 50 percent FG shooting, going 7-3 ATS over that stretch.

Why Duke can cover the spread

The Blue Devils are back in the Sweet 16 following their 89-67 victory over Iona in the first round and their 87-62 rout of Rhode Island in the second round. Duke covered a 20-point spread against the Gaels and a nine-point spread against the Rams.

The Blue Devils used a 23-5 run midway through the first half against Rhode Island to take a 17-point lead into halftime. Duke later led by 29 in a totally dominating performance against what was a hot Rams team.

On the afternoon, the Blue Devils shot 56.9 percent from the field, made 10 of 21 from three-point land and held URI to just 39.7 percent FG shooting. Two days prior, Duke shot 54 percent from the floor while holding Iona to 43 percent shooting.

The Blue Devils are now 11-5 SU and 10-6 ATS this season against teams that made the NCAA tournament.

Smart betting pick

Duke beat Syracuse just one month ago 60-44 and covered a 13-point spread. However, that was only a seven-point game with 10 minutes to go. The Orange are better now than they were then, playing tough and with great confidence. Syracuse might not win this game, but the smart money takes the points.

March Madness betting trends

The total has gone under in eight of Duke's last 10 games.

Duke is 9-2 SU and ATS in its last 11 games as a favorite.

Duke is 53-5 SU in its last 58 games as a double-digit favorite.
